Our Vision & Mission

Our mission is to provide the highest quality medical care available in our service area within our scope of care. We will continue to have a reputation for having highly knowledgeable and technically skilled staff members providing outstanding patient care in state of the art facilities with genuine kindness and compassion for others.

Compassionate Care at Home The Latest News From SHA

Our Home Health services allow individuals the freedom to live in an environment that is often the most familiar and comfortable for them, with the care and skill of home healthcare providers to ensure they get the care they need. Homebound individuals who are under the care of a physician requiring nursing or therapy services.
